Chevron rebrands greases

March 13, 2023
2 min read

Chevron has rebranded it grease lineup, renaming products and refreshing its packaging.

Package designs include a simplified naming structure that categorizes products by thickening agents. Packaging includes key product details and a QR code that provides access to more information.

Chevron grease lineup

  • Simple Lithium, including Multifak and Ultra-Duty, heavy-duty multipurpose greases for extreme-pressure applications.
  • Lithium Complex, featuring Starplex grease, good for extra-duty, heavy-duty and extreme pressure applications.
  • Polyurea, including the Black Pearl product line, for filled-for-life and high-speed motor applications.
  • Specialty, including premium Texclad grease, an extra-duty product for sprayable applications.

“By reinvigorating our line of grease products, we believe it will be easier for customers to understand our product portfolio,” said Zach Sutton, industrial & services sector specialist, in a prepared statement. “Long term, we believe having a diverse portfolio across thickener types will meet the needs of our customers for all of their applications, both now and in the future.”

Chevron will be adding a Calcium Sulfonate Complex category with the Rykon brand name in 2023, with a focus on increasing equipment longevity, extended lubrication intervals, and reducing the total consumption needed to keep an operation up and running.
